    1. The Associated Press‏Verified account @AP 25 Jun 2021

      Ex-Officer Derek Chauvin sentenced to 22 1/2 years in prison for killing George Floyd, whose dying gasps under Chauvin’s knee led to reckoning on racial injustice.http://apne.ws/73tgoE9

      The Associated Press‏Verified account @AP 25 Jun 2021

      The fired white Minneapolis officer was convicted in April of second-degree unintentional murder, third-degree murder and second-degree manslaughter for pressing his knee against George Floyd’s neck for up to 9 1/2 minutes.http://apne.ws/K4rNd5v

        1. The Associated Press‏Verified account @AP 25 Jun 2021

          The punishment handed out Friday fell short of the 30 years that prosecutors had requested. With good behavior, Chauvin, 45, could be paroled after serving two-thirds of his sentence, or about 15 years.http://apne.ws/TScvgl2
